Those sanctioned include the secretary of Iran’s Supreme Council for National Security and four other local military and police commanders.

The U.S. Treasury Department announced new sanctions on Jan. 15 targeting Iranian officials said to be responsible for organizing the violent suppression of protests against the Tehran regime.

In all, the Treasury Department targeted five individuals it connected to Iran’s efforts to violently throttle protests.
